About LINC Education
LINC Education (https://linceducation.com) is an award-winning, global EdTech company on a mission to democratise premium international education. Headquartered in Singapore with offices in Australia and India, we combine proprietary AI technology with a network of 1,000+ global educators to deliver world-class university programs. We also own and operate The WorldGrad (http://www.theworldgrad.com), India's largest study abroad platform.

Role Description
The ‘Manager - Program Management’ will be instrumental in ensuring LINC Education continues to deliver personalised learning experiences to our 40,000+ students globally. This role is critical for driving the successful execution of our online programs, optimising operational workflows, and maintaining the highest standards of delivery across our diverse portfolio. By leading key initiatives and bridging the gap between strategy and execution, you will directly impact student retention, partner satisfaction, and LINC’s global growth.
Key Responsibilities
Operational
- Program Delivery: Oversee the end-to-end delivery of assigned programs, ensuring that all milestones, service-level agreements (SLAs), and quality benchmarks are consistently met.
- Resource Coordination: Manage project timelines, allocate tasks effectively within the program team, and proactively mitigate risks or bottlenecks to keep delivery on track.
- Daily Problem Solving: Serve as the primary escalation point for operational issues, troubleshooting day-to-day challenges to ensure seamless program execution.
Strategic
- Process Optimisation: Evaluate existing program management workflows to identify inefficiencies, designing and implementing scalable processes to improve productivity and quality.
- Data & Analytics: Contribute towards program reporting and data management activities; analyse key performance metrics (such as student engagement and operational throughput) to generate actionable insights for leadership.
Collaborative
- Cross-Functional Alignment: Work closely with internal teams, such as Academic, Learning Design, Product/Tech, and Student Support teams, to ensure cross-functional alignment and effective delivery of all programs.
- Client Management: Collaborate with university partners and external stakeholders to understand their requirements, present progress updates, and maintain strong, trust-based relationships.
